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Redditch to Bexley start from as little as £12.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Redditch to Bexley start from £49.90 one way, or £50.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Redditch to Bexley are available for £90.50 one way, or £145.50 return

Station Facilities and Ticketing

Redditch train station is equipped with a ticket office that operates various hours throughout the week, with extended hours on Fridays and Saturdays. There are ticket machines available at the station, including accessible ones located conveniently in the car park. For those purchasing tickets online, collection is straightforward with designated machines ensuring a smooth experience.

The station offers step-free access to all platforms, making it an accessible choice for passengers with mobility needs. With helpful staff available to assist during most station hours and the presence of assistance points, valid support ensures a stress-free journey.

Security is prioritized with CCTV cameras in place, although luggage storage facilities are not available. While waiting rooms are absent, seating areas offer comfortable spots to relax before embarking on your journey. The station does not provide refreshment facilities, but this gives an excellent opportunity to explore local cafes and eateries nearby.

Onward Travel and Transport Links

Redditch station is well-integrated with local transport options. Taxis can be easily hailed with services such as Premier, ABC, and AA Falcon all available for quick access. For those looking to continue their journey by bus, printable information is available to assist in planning your travels. Rail replacement services also operate from the station's car park during service disruptions, ensuring that your journey remains unchanged.

The station is bicycle-friendly, boasting 18 storage spaces for cyclists though cycling hire services are not provided. This encourages eco-friendly travel and a healthy lifestyle amongst commuters. As part of the Secure Station Scheme, Redditch Station offers peace of mind to its passengers.

Facilities and Amenities at Bexley Station

Step into Bexley Station and find convenience at every corner. The ticket office opens early at 6:10 AM on weekdays and Saturdays (and slightly later at 8:10 AM on Sundays), closing at 7:30 PM and 3:40 PM respectively, ensuring you have ample time to secure travel essentials. In the mood for a quiet coffee while waiting for your train? Head over to the coffee kiosk or vending machines available for refreshments. Though the station lacks an ATM, induction loops, smartcard validators, and accessible ticket machines are strategically placed for your ease of use.

If you require assistance, Bexley Station doesn't disappoint. With customer help points and staffed service till late evening on most days, help is only a request away. For those needing step-free access, the station accommodates well; the entire premises provide step-free access to both platforms and the booking hall. There are secure accreditations in place, and CCTV is operational, ensuring a safe surrounding for peace of mind.

Seamless Transport Connections

For those looking to reach their next destination beyond the tracks, Bexley Station is well-connected. Replacement services heading toward destinations like Dartford can be found at Bus Stop D on Bexley High Street. Likewise, if you're heading towards Sidcup, head to Stop E for convenient access. Detailed information on bus services is available, ensuring you have all you need to plan your onward journey.
